To cultivate employment equity effectively, organizations must implement a comprehensive set of strategies. It is essential to perform regular evaluations to identify potential gaps and develop targeted interventions. Establishing clear procedures that promote fairness and accountability is crucial. Providing inclusive training and development programs can help bridge the gap for historically underrepresented groups.
- Creating a culture of inclusion where all employees feel respected
- Recruiting from a diverse pool of candidates through targeted outreach
- Sponsoring programs to support the advancement of employees from underrepresented groups
By implementing these strategies, organizations can create a more equitable and fair workplace for all.

Building a Powerful Employment Equity Committee: A Step-by-Step Guide
Establishing an impactful employment equity committee is crucial for fostering a diverse and inclusive workplace. Initiate your journey by clarifying the committee's mission. Describe its functions clearly, ensuring alignment with your organization's principles. Select committee members from diverse backgrounds and divisions to guarantee a broad outlook.
Offer the committee with the resources, development, and guidance. Promote open communication among members and with parties throughout its organization. Regularly meetings to track progress, address challenges, and acknowledge successes.
- Execute data-driven strategies to enhance diversity and inclusion.
- Assess the committee's success through indicators and perform necessary adjustments.
- Pledge to ongoing learning, reflection, and development to build a truly equitable workplace for all.
Present Your Employment Equity Report with Confidence
Submitting your Employment Equity Report can feel daunting, but it doesn't have to be. By following these Processes, you can navigate the Submission with ease and confidence.
First, Meticulously review the Reporting Guidelines provided by your Jurisdiction. This will help ensure that your Report is complete and Accurate.
Next, Compile all Required information, including Demographics on your workforce. Structure this Material clearly and concisely to make it Accessible for reviewers.
Once you've Prepared your Submission, double-check for any Errors. It's also a good idea to have someone else review your Effort for a Fresh perspective.
Finally, Deliver your Document by the Due Date specified. You can usually File your Document online or by Mail.
Note that submitting your Employment Equity Document is not a one-time Task. It's an ongoing Journey to ensuring fairness and equity in the workplace.
